Recently I had the opportunity to participate in a weekend conference. I was asked to be a speaker, sell my books as a vendor, and conduct a live airing of my internet show The Magnolia. I was delighted to do so.

When I arrived at 7:45am to get everything set up for the 8:30am opening of the conference, I saw name signs at the various vendor tables of banks, retail businesses, and major corporations. I thought to myself, this is going to be beneficial. Then I saw some of the people representing those companies in outfits that should have only been worn in the yard working in the dirt. People were dressed entirely too casual for a business setting and the impact was certainly not positive. Maybe they thought since it was Saturday they could get away with it. I thought at one point of the movie The Mask where Jim Carey yells out something like “Somebody please HELP me!” I could not believe they were wearing flip flops, t-shirts, and shorts.

When participating in a conference or convention, no matter the role, remember you are representing your company and you. Dress appropriately in your company logo attire making sure the items are pressed, slacks and a long sleeved shirt for men and long sleeved blouses or sweaters for women. Also remember that convention centers are usually cool so a sweater or jacket is in order.

Remember there will be plenty of other times to wear that yard outfit!

Your image is always showing.
